Introduction to Edwardian Conservatories

Originating in the early 20th century throughout the reign of King Edward VII, the Edwardian conservatory style is characterized by its spacious layout, pitched roofing system, and big glass panels. Its design prioritizes both light and area, making it a perfect choice for property owners seeking to enjoy the charm of their gardens throughout the year.

Secret Features of Edwardian Conservatories

FunctionDescription
Pitched RoofOffers a greater ceiling and allows for better drainage, making it visually pleasing.
Square or Rectangular ShapeMakes the most of flooring area, offering a practical layout for various usages.
Big Glass PanelsFloods the space with natural light, producing a warm and welcoming environment.
Brick or Stone BaseProvides stability and blends seamlessly with conventional home designs.
Dwarf WallsThese low walls support the glass, providing both insulation and a visual anchor for the structure.

Design Considerations for Bespoke Edwardian Conservatories

While the benefits of an Edwardian conservatory are attracting, a number of considerations need to be taken into consideration throughout the design phase:

ConsiderationDescription
LocationDetermine the best location for optimum sun exposure and views, while considering existing landscaping.
ProductsSelect premium products for both structure and windows to guarantee resilience and energy performance.
Glass TypeGo with double or triple glazing to improve insulation and minimize energy costs.
VentilationIncorporate opening windows or roof vents to promote air flow and control temperature level.
Heating/Cooling OptionsConsider integrating underfloor heating or a/c for year-round comfort.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How much does a bespoke Edwardian conservatory cost?

The expense differs based upon size, materials, and design intricacy. A standard Edwardian conservatory can range from ₤ 10,000 to ₤ 30,000 or more. It's vital to acquire quotes from numerous specialists for a more accurate estimate.

2. Do I need planning authorization for a conservatory?

Oftentimes, conservatories are thought about permitted advancements. However, if your home is noted or found in a sanctuary, you might need to request preparing consent. Constantly consult your local council.

3. What products are best for an Edwardian conservatory?

Popular materials include uPVC, wood, and aluminum. Each material provides different visual and efficiency advantages, so it's crucial to consider what will best match your home and environment.

4. Can I use my conservatory year-round?

Yes, with proper insulation and environment control options such as heating or a/c, a bespoke Edwardian conservatory can be comfortable and usable throughout the year.

5. How do I preserve my Edwardian conservatory?

Routine maintenance entails cleaning the glass panels, examining seals for leakages, and ensuring that drain systems are clear. It's also a good idea to check the structure occasionally for any signs of wear or damage.
